Ruyigi : a woman and a child injured with a machete in Kayongozi
Anne Nzeyimana was seriously injured with a machete on her face and both arms last Tuesday. The incident occured on the hill of Nkanda, in the Kayongozi zone, in the commune of Bweru in the province of Ruyigi (eastern Burundi). The information is confirmed by Jean Bosco Ndayisaba, the head of the Kayongozi zone, who specifies that a three-year-old child, Don de Dieu Uwihanganye, was slightly injured at the leg. A witness specifies that the woman and the child were initially admitted to the Kayongozi health center for first aid. Anne Nzeyimana was transferred to Ruyigi hospital in the provincial capital, as the health services in Kayongozi were unable to treat her.
Kayongozi zone chief Jean Bosco Ndayisaba says that the author of this barbarism has been identified.
He was apprehended on Tuesday evening on the hill of Gashurushuru in the commune of Butezi (same province).
For the moment, the suspect is incarcerated in the police cell of the Kayongozi zone. He should be tried in a swift trial.
Mr. Ndayisaba indicates that the motives behind the act would be linked to witchcraft and asks the population to avoid mob justice.
